Max Alperts photograph Kombat of Junior Politruk Aleksei Yeryomenko, minutes before his death on 12 July 1942, in Voroshilovgrad Oblast, Ukraine and an outline of the five-pointed star going over from the disc to the ring. In the upper part of the ring - the inscription along the rim: 55 (55TH ANNIVERSARY OF THE GREAT VICTORY), in the lower one - the dates 1941 1945.

In the centre - the indication of the face value of the coin "10 РУБЛЕЙ" (10 ROUBLES). Inside of the figure "0" - hidden pictures of the figure "10" and of the inscription "РУБЛЕЙ" (ROUBLES) visible by turns only on changing the angle of vision. In the lower part of the disc - the mint trade mark. In the upper part of the ring -the inscription along the rim: "БАНК РОССИИ" (BANK OF RUSSIA), in the lower one - the date "2000", to the left and to the right - stylized twigs of plants going over to the disc.
